当前位置:文档之家› 世界500强公司上海杉达学院校招面试题

世界500强公司上海杉达学院校招面试题

R & D POSITION SCHOOL RECRUITMENT
研发部门职位通用
校招题库
51企营企业管理资料文集
1、类A 是类B 的友元,类C 是类A 的公有派生类,忽略特殊情况则下列说法正确的是()
A、类B 是类A 的友元
B、类C 不是类B 的友元
C、类C 是类B 的友元
D、类B 不是类A 的友元
参考答案:
2、现有4 个同时到达的作业J1,J2,J3 和J4,它们的执行时间分别是3 小时,5 小时,7 小时,9 小时系统按单
道方式运行且采用短作业优先算法,则平均周转时间是()小时
A、12.5
B、24
C、19
D、6
参考答案:
3、下面程序输出结果是什么?
1. #include<iostream>
2. using namespace std;
3. class A{
4. public:
5. A(char *s)
6. {
7. cout<<s<<endl;
8. }
9. ~A(){}
10. };
11. class B:virtual public A
12. { public:
13. B(char
14. *s1,char*s2):A(s1){ cout<<s2<<en
15. dl;
16. }
17. };
18. class C:virtual public A
19. { public:
20. C(char
21. *s1,char*s2):A(s1){ cout<<s2<<en
22. dl;
23. }
24. };
25. class D:public B,public C
26. { public:
27. D(char *s1,char *s2,char *s3,char *s4):B(s1,s2),C(s1,s3),A(s1)
28. {
29. cout<<s4<<endl;
30. }
31. };
32. int main() {
33. D *p=new D("class A","class B","class C","class D");
34. delete p;
35. return 0;
36. }
A、class A class B class C class D
B、class D class B class C class A
C、class D class C class B class A
D、class A class C class B class D
参考答案:
4、关于C++/JAVA类中的static成员和对象成员的说法正确的是:
A、static成员变量在对象构造时候生成
B、static成员函数在对象成员函数中无法调用
C、虚成员函数不可能是static成员函数
D、static成员函数不能访问static成员变量
参考答案:
5、一个全局变量tally,两个线程并发执行(代码段都是ThreadProc),问两个线程都结束后,tally 取值范围为
1. int tally=0;//全局变量
2. void ThreadProc(){
3. for(int i=1;i<=50;i++) 4
4. tally+=1;
5. }
A、[50,100]
B、[100.100]
C、[1275,2550]
D、[2550,2550]
参考答案:
6、主机甲向主机乙发送一个(SYN=1,seq=11220)的TCP 段,期望与主机乙建立TCP 连接,若主机乙接受该连接
请求,则主机乙向主机甲发送的正确的TCP 段应该是()
A、(SYN=1,ACK=1,seq=11220,ack=11220)
B、(SYN=1,ACK=1,seq=11221,ack=11221)
C、(SYN=0,ACK=0,seq=11221,ack=11221)
D、(SYN=1,ACK=1,seq=11220,ack=11220)
参考答案:
7、HTTP的会话有四个过程,请选出不是的一个()
A、建立连接
B、发出响应信息
C、发出请求信息
D、传输数据
参考答案:
8、某学校获取到一个B 类地址段,要给大家分开子网使用,鉴于现在上网设备急剧增多, 管理员给每个网段进
行划分的子网掩码设置为255.255.254.0,考虑每个网段需要有网关设备占用一个地址的情况下,每个网段还有多少可用的主机地址()
A、509。

相关主题